Environment (Protection) Act 1986 – s.3 – 1994 Environmental Impact Assessment (EIA) notification mandated prior Environmental Clearance (EC) for setting up and expansion of indu strial units falling within thirty categories – Deadline extende d by various circulars – 2002 Circular while further extending t he deadline allowed for ex post facto ECs – Quashed by National Green Tribunal (NGT) – On appeal, held: Concept of an ex post facto EC is in derogation of the fundamental principles of environ mental jurisprudence – It is an anathema to the 1994 EIA not ification – Allowing for an ex post
